The International Plant Protection Convention (IPPC) has been, and continues to be, administered at the national level by plant quarantine officials whose primary objective is to safeguard plant resources from injurious pests. In the United States , the national plant protection organization is APHIS' Plant Protection and Quarantine (PPQ) program.
